We open this episode with another installment of "Bidet Mate", then discuss the origins of the Ancient Olympics, and the history of the Modern Olympics, which began 1,500 years later. We also cover the first few Olympic Games, which were plagued by issues caused by poor planning, bad luck and plain old ineptitude. But far and away the best story we cover is that of Cuban long distance runner Felix Carvajal, who is definitely one of the more interesting and colorful characters in Olympic history.
